HIGH PRESSURE IN WELLHEAD BLEW, INJURING EMPLOYEES

THE EMPLOYEES WERE CHANGING TUBING STEEL AT THE WELLHEAD. EMPLOYEE #3 BACKED DOWN THE LOCKING SCREWS OF THE "PACK OFF", LOCATED BETWEEN THE SEVEN INCH CASING AND THE 10 3/4 INCH SURFACE PIPE. THERE WAS ABOUT 850 PSI IN THE ANNULUS OF THE WELL BELOW THE "PACK-OFF". WHEN THE LAST LOCK-DOWN SCREW WAS LOOSENED, THE "PACK-OFF" FLEW OFF ITS SEAT. THE "ARCTIC PACK" FLUID WAS EJECTED UNDER GREAT PRESSURE. THE FOUR EMPLOYEES WERE KNOCKED BACKWARDS BY THE RELEASE OF HIGH PRESSURE. THE WELLHEAD EQUIPMENT WAS MANUFACTURED BY THE F.M.C. CORPORATION (GENERATION ONE). EMPLOYEE #1 RECIEVED A DISLOCATED SHOULDER. EMPLOYEES #2 AND #3 RECIEVED "ARCTIC PACK" SKIN PENETRATIONS. EMPLOYEE #4 RECIEVED A FRACTURED VERTEBRA AND HEAD LACERATIONS. NONE OF THE EMPLOYEES THOUGHT TO CHECK THE PRESSURE IN THE ANNULUS BEFORE LOOSENING THE LOCK-DOWN SCREWS.
